For a 400-guest wedding, the allocation of your budget will typically look like this:
Choosing the right venue is crucial. Premium venues in Halifax, such as the Halifax Convention Centre or Dalhousie University’s Alumni Hall, can provide the elegant atmosphere that a Sikh wedding demands. Expect to invest around 30% of your total budget on venue rental, which includes space for both the ceremony and reception.
Food is a centerpiece of any Sikh wedding, with a budget allocation of about 35%. In Halifax, per-plate costs for traditional Indian catering typically range from C$70 to C$120. With 400 guests, this can add up quickly. Consider including a mix of vegetarian and non-vegetarian options to cater to your guests' preferences.
Decor plays a significant role in setting the tone of your wedding. Allocate around 15% of your budget for decor, which may include floral arrangements, stage setups, and lighting. Engaging local decorators who specialize in Sikh weddings can ensure that your vision is beautifully realized.
Entertainment should not be overlooked. Expect to spend about 20% of your budget on live music, DJs, or traditional performers like bhangra dancers. This will help create a festive atmosphere that reflects the joyous spirit of your celebration.
When compared to other major North American cities, Halifax generally offers more affordable options, particularly for venues and catering. Cities like Toronto and Vancouver often see higher costs due to their larger markets and demand. By planning your wedding in Halifax, you can enjoy premium services at a more reasonable price point.
